Start Microsoft Outlook.
Open the Address Book.
|
 |
|
In the Address Book, click the Tools menu, and then click Accounts.
A window titled "Internet Accounts" should open up.
|
 |
|
In the "Internet Accounts" window, Click the Add button.
|
 |
|
An Internet Directory Server Name Window opens.
Type ldap.uab.edu in the Blank space (a)
UAB Hospital also has an LDAP server - repeat these instructions but
Set the Internet Directory Server Name to gw5.uabmc.edu
Do NOT check the box requiring a log on (b)
Click the Next button(c)
|
 |
|
Click the Yes radio button to indicate that you DO want to use this directory service
Click the Next button
|
 |
Set the Friendly Name to UAB Phonebook.
UAB Hospital also has an LDAP server - repeat these instructions but set the Friendly Name to UAB Hospital
Click the Next button.
|
 |
|
Click the Finish button on the Congratulations screen
|
 |
|
You should see the UAB Phonebook entry listed under Directory Services (a)
Click the Set Order button (b)
|
 |
|
Look at your list of Directory Services. (a) If you have more than one listed, you may want to be sure that your department's service is listed first.
If you need to adjust the order, use the Move Up and Move Down buttons (b)
Save your changes by clicking the OK button (c)
|
 |
|
In the Address Book, click the Tools menu, and then click Accounts.
A window titled "Internet Accounts" should open up.
|
 |
|
Highlight ldap.uab.edu
Click the Properties button
|
 |
|
In the Properties Window,
Click the tab labeled Advanced (a)
Leave Directory Service set to 389, which is the default setting (b)
Set the search base to: o=uab.edu (c)
UAB Hospital also has an LDAP server - repeat these instructions but
Set the search base to o=uab
Click the OK Button (d)
